Employee of the Month for September

Vicki Yencha

Congratulations to Vicki Yencha, , who has been selected as Employee of the Month for September! 

Vicki has been a member of the WVU Parkersburg Business Office staff since October, 1999.  She has served as a representative on Staff Council, the Social Justice Committee, Appalachian Heritage Days, the American Sampler, chaired the Christmas luncheon, and is a team member of the WVU Parkersburg Relay for Life.

Vicki is a graduate of Parkersburg Community College with an Associate in Applied Science Degree. 

Vicki and her husband Tom (WVU Parkersburg’s Director of Student Activities) live in Parkersburg.  They have two daughters, Moriah, 15, a sophomore at Parkersburg Catholic and Bethany, 21, grandson Dre, 6 months, 7 cats and 2 dogs.

In her spare time Vicki loves to garden, read, crafts of all kinds and painting.  Finishing their house is her biggest hobby right now. 

Following is an excerpt from the nominations that served as the basis for Vicki’s selection as Employee of the Month:

“Vickie is one of the college's unsung heroes.  For the most part her work goes unnoticed, she is located back in the dark, hot recesses of the college and in fact her job is one nobody enjoys - paying the bills.  But, let someone's travel reimbursement be a little late - then everyone knows who she is.  I have seen reimbursement time go from 1 month - if lucky, to about a week now.   Vickie has worked hard to speed these processes up and to ensure our paperwork is done in a timely manner and our money gets back to us quickly or that the bills get paid on time. I feel she deserves our thanks and recognition for a job well done.”
